How KYC Kills Momentum

KYC – Know Your Customer – is the bureaucratic gatekeeping that standard casinos force on you. They want a government-issued ID, proof of your address, sometimes proof of income, and a selfie to confirm you’re the person in the photo. It can take days, sometimes longer. No KYC casinos skip all that. You give them a username, a password, and an email. Deposit with Bitcoin, Litecoin, Ethereum, Dogecoin, or USDT, and you’re playing inside five minutes. Withdrawals are the real win: crypto payouts hit your wallet instantly, no review queue. Cards and e-wallets take a little longer, but compared to traditional sites that hold your cash for a week while they “verify,” it’s night and day.

When the KYC Check Still Finds You

Even no verification casinos can ask for ID. It happens on first-time withdrawals, suspicious account activity, or if you try to cash out too much too fast. These checks are about anti-fraud and anti-money laundering, not about messing with you. You can reduce the chance by keeping deposits and withdrawals consistent – no sudden spikes, no bonus abuse, no switching wallets every week. Join a VIP program for higher limits and faster processing. Split large withdrawals into several smaller ones. None of this guarantees you won’t get flagged, but it helps.

Bonuses and Banking: What Actually Works

These sites still offer welcome bonuses, free spins, referral rewards, cashback, and no deposit offers – same as traditional casinos. The difference is the banking. Crypto is fastest: instant deposits, instant withdrawals. Credit and debit cards work but often trigger a verification request. Bank transfers are slow and almost always require ID. E-wallets like Skrill and Neteller sit in the middle – fast, but some bonuses exclude them.

If you want to avoid verification entirely, stick to crypto. Keep your wallet consistent. Don’t abuse the system.
